Job summary

A major utility company in Manchester is seeking a confident technical leader to oversee the Streetworks audit and laboratory testing programme. This permanent position includes managerial responsibilities, requiring expertise in NRSWA compliance and strong leadership skills. The ideal candidate will have over 5 years of relevant experience, full NRSWA qualifications, and certifications like IOSH or NEBOSH. The role offers 26 days of holiday plus bank holidays and up to 14% employer pension contribution.

Benefits

26 days holiday + 8 bank holidays
Up to 14% employer pension contribution

Qualifications

  • Full NRSWA Supervisor and Operative qualifications.
  • IOSH or NEBOSH certification for construction site auditing.
  • Extensive experience in streetworks auditing, testing and compliance (5+ years).
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office with proven budget management.

Responsibilities

  • Lead all streetworks audits and inspections.
  • Manage and develop the Streetworks Compliance Team.
  • Act as Laboratory Manager, ensuring regulatory compliance.
  • Oversee contracts, budgets, and relationships with stakeholders.
  • Serve as technical authority on NRSWA and best practices.
  • Drive continuous improvement in streetworks quality.
